A former Invesco Ltd. media relations director who was awarded $1 million by a jury after she claimed she was fired for taking time off under the Family and Medical Leave Act told a Texas federal judge the company isn't entitled to the new trial it's seeking.

A Texas federal judge rejected a Black former Invesco employee's request for a new trial against the company over her racial bias claims, but sanctioned the investment management company's attorneys for their "egregious" pretrial conduct.

After winning a $1 million jury verdict for leave claims, a Black former Invesco employee urged a Texas federal court to grant her a new damages trial related to racial discrimination charges, arguing that the company never investigated the bias allegations and misled the court.

A Texas federal jury has said that Invesco Ltd. should shell out $1 million to compensate a former media relations director who claimed the investment management company fired her for taking time off under the Family and Medical Leave Act.
